SCOTUS Decision Will Harm Women and Girls
- By Eagle Forum
Last Monday morning, in a 6-3 decision, the Supreme Court of the United States ruled in Bostock v. Clayton County that title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964 extends to individuals identifying as gay or transgender. The majority position, written by Justice Neil Gorsuch stated:
“An individual’s homosexuality or transgender status is not relevant to employment decisions That’s because it is impossible to discriminate against a person for being homosexual or transgender without discriminating against that individual based on sex.”

Ohio Health Director Acton Resigns After Operation Rescue Published Disturbing Information from Interview with Acton's Estranged Mother
- By Operation Rescue
COLUMBUS, Ohio -- Ohio Department of Health Director Amy Acton resigned suddenly today, citing inability to cope with the overload of work the job required. Acton will reportedly stay on as Gov. Mike DeWine's "Chief Health Advisor."
This came a week after Operation Rescue called for her resignation after publishing an exposé that included information on her Ohio medical license application that indicated she had been treated for mental illness and/or addiction issues at some point in the past.
